** The Subaru repair market in Whiteface itself is virtually non-existent due to the town's small size. Residents must travel to Lubbock, approximately 40 miles north, for specialized automotive service. The Lubbock market features moderate competition with several independent shops capable of servicing Subarus, but only a handful have cultivated a specific reputation for expertise with the brand's unique engineering. The quality of service is generally high among the top-tier shops, which invest in ongoing technician training. Pricing is competitive with national averages; a complex job like a head gasket replacement on a Subaru boxer engine typically ranges from $2,200 to $3,000, while standard maintenance like a CVT fluid change costs between $250 and $400. For highly specialized services like official EyeSight calibration, residents often have no choice but to visit the local Subaru dealership, which was not included in this list as it focuses on non-dealership specialists.

In our high-plains climate with dusty, unpaved roads, common issues include clogged air filters, worn suspension components from rough terrain, and CV joint wear on all-wheel-drive systems. Head gasket concerns on older models (pre-2012) and check engine lights related to the emissions system are also frequent repairs we see locally.
Given the rural setting, seek shops in nearby larger towns like Littlefield or Lubbock that specifically list Subaru or Asian import expertise. Look for ASE-certified technicians and ask local Subaru owners for referrals, as word-of-mouth is key in our community for finding mechanics familiar with the brand's unique boxer engines and symmetrical AWD.
Labor rates in the Whiteface area may be slightly lower, but parts often need to be ordered from distributors in Lubbock or beyond, which can add time and sometimes shipping costs. For complex issues, the expertise of a specialized Subaru technician might require a trip to Lubbock, balancing travel against potential higher urban shop rates.
Seek immediate service if you notice binding or jerking during turns, hear clicking from the wheels, or see a dashboard AWD warning light. Given our local conditions with sudden weather changes and loose soil, ensuring the AWD system is functional is crucial for safe driving on county roads and during our occasional heavy rains or ice.
The abundant dust, caliche roads, and long, hot summers mean you should adhere strictly to oil change intervals and inspect air filters and cabin filters more frequently. It's also wise to have undercarriage and suspension checks more often than recommended to catch wear from rough ranch and farm access roads early.
